The video tutorial covers Unit 3, Lesson 1 on building blocks and systems. It begins with an introduction to key vocabulary terms related to the human body, such as cells, tissues, and organs. Ricardo, a fourth-grade student, introduces himself and Dr. Wild Body, a pediatrician who uses rhymes to teach about the body. The lesson includes an overview of various body systems, including skeletal, muscular, nervous, digestive, excretory, circulatory, and respiratory systems, using riddles to engage students. The tutorial explains how organ systems are composed of organs, tissues, and cells, highlighting the importance of cells as the building blocks of life. The video concludes with a summary and a transition to the next lesson.
